New job creation enterprise for disability, Indigenous groups
A disability services organisation, an Indigenous construction company and management services group have joined forces to create jobs for those with disability and Indigenous people, in an Australian-first private-sector collaboration.
Australian Assists driving inclusion globally
Australia Assists Program is deploying people with disability who have been trained for disaster and preparedness in a humanitarian crisis.
